# Fan-out backpressure controls for the Heathrow-Pine notification
# service. When a broadcast targets more subscribers than the burst
# window allows, excess deliveries are shed into the deferred queue
# and drained at a fixed rate. New team members: this is intentional;
# slow delivery beats melting the push gateway. The deferred queue is
# bounded, and overflow drops low-priority notices first. Tune only
# after checking gateway dashboards, since these values were chosen
# from the spring load tests. The governing constants appear below.

tuning constants:
QUOTAS = {
    "oliix": 5,
    "quenix": 2,
}

Subject: Dedupe pass shipping in Quillbarn 2.9

Team — the customer-record deduplication job is merged and scheduled for tonight's release. Reviewers: the merge strategy now prefers the most recently verified record and archives losers rather than deleting. Please spot-check the reconciliation report after the first run. The candidate build carries the trace token shown below.

session token of tajef-bageg = htk21_5d90d574934f3ccae6437

## Registry outage: event schema fetch failures

If consumers report schema-not-found errors, verify the Corvane registry pods are healthy, then confirm the cache tier is warm. Flush only if versions are mismatched. All admin calls go through the Corvane internal endpoint and require authentication. Use the admin key below for these operations.

gateway credential: kto3_qfe

First-day checklist item: While Harwick House is under renovation, all new starters at Pellerton Group report to the temporary site at Crane Mews instead. Walk them past the loading bay to the side entrance, as the main doors are boarded up. The hoarding gate stays locked before 8:30, so they'll need the temporary pass code to get through.

staff pass of kawip-hawef = bdg-QLP-2